Ticket: Cron drift on Pipewren scheduler hosts

Plugin authors have reported jobs firing up to four minutes late on the shared Pipewren scheduler. We traced this to configuration drift: two of the three scheduler hosts picked up an older tick-interval override during last month's rebuild. Plugins should not compensate with their own timers — we'll converge the hosts this week. For transparency, the drifted hosts are currently running with the following values.

config for kafof-bawef:
holath:
  log_level: debug
  metrics_host: metrics.holath.qorvelsys.internal
  pin: 2191
  pool_size: 32

You're now first responder for the Larkspun contrast audit. Scope: all customer-facing screens in the Brightmoor console. Failures show up as CONTRAST_FAIL entries in the audit dashboard; threshold is WCAG AA. Do not merge UI changes that add new failures — block the review and tag the design owner. Known exceptions (legacy charts, the onboarding carousel) are whitelisted already. Anything outside the whitelist needs a ticket before release. Escalation rota, token mappings, and remediation steps are on the internal page below.

wiki page, hahif-hahif: https://argocd.kelvisys.corp/browse/board/settings/pages/1442e0b1065d83f1

Heads up for the weekly sync: the Mapletide lookup API has been flaking, and it's DNS again. The internal resolver pool occasionally returns empty answers for the lookup endpoint under load, so clients see connection errors even though the service is healthy. Workaround for now: the client library pins resolved addresses for five minutes and falls back to the secondary resolver on failure. While testing the fallback path, authenticate against the staging lookup service using the key shown just below.

app token of kagap-fahag = zpat2_0m